Starting this week, shoppers at Target, CVS, and Kroger in Southern California will notice big changes: plastic bags are on their way out, and forgetting your reusable bag will soon cost you. Ahead of a statewide ban in 2026, these stores are rolling out a campaign to ditch single-use plastic bags, with paper or reusable bags available for at least 10 cents each.
